Genoa president Enrico Preziosi threatens to quit in Atalanta humiliation aftermath

Genoa president Enrico Preziosi has threatened to quit after their humiliation by Atalanta.

Preziosi was protested by angry fans following the 5-0 defeat.

“I saw what they wrote and what they have been saying," Preziosi told Sky Sport Italia.

“It is an expression of their dissatisfaction and I respect that. What angers me is personal insults aimed at my family.

“We hit rock bottom again today. This is our situation. If that's what the Genoa fans want, and their messages were clear, then I'll make them happy. We'll do what we have to do…

“They don't want Preziosi? Fine. Someone else will come. Good luck to whoever does arrive, but until then I will continue along my path.

“I will try to make the fans happy."
